New snow and partly sunny skies

We received 1 to 2 inches of new snow last night on top. I skied Thomke’s this morning and was able to find some fresh snow. The wind blew the new snow around a bit, but there were some nice pockets. The sun came out and warmed things up giving us some spring conditions at lower elevations in the afternoon. Tomorrow we plan to have skiing and riding on all 3 mountains with 6 lifts operating, including Madonna II and Morse Highlands. The Madonna I Lift will be closed tomorrow to allow us more time to groom Upper FIS. We plan to have the Madonna I Lift open again on Wednesday. We will have 32 trails open tomorrow with terrain for all ability levels. 28 trails will be groomed for tomorrow, including Log Jam, McPherson’s, Playground, Lower Chilcoot, Smugglers’ Alley, Snake Bite, and Garden Path for a grand total of 115 acres of freshly groomed terrain. Surface conditions are machine groomed and variable with average base depths of 6 to 40 inches. Currently, it is partly sunny and 27 degrees at the summit of Sterling with winds of 5 to 10 mph. Tomorrow’s forecast is calling for partly sunny skies with a high of 38 degrees at the base and 24 degrees at higher elevations.
